The FCM-802/804 provides regulated DC at nominal output voltage, which can be defined by the user at a nominal 24V or 48V. The FCM-802/804 will hold the DC output at the nominal voltage while connected to an external battery or power supply so that the system will act as a hybrid system.
Do NOT disconnect the main power leads with the enable signal present. Warning: When the FCM-802/804 is running it will stay live if the power cables are disconnected. Warning: EVEN when the FCM802/804 is NOT running the cables may still be powered from the load side battery or external power source.

There are four potential free contacts (PFC) for auxiliary signals to and from the FCM. The PFCs are setup to be one output and three inputs. These are software configurable by Intelligent Energy. The signals are shown in the following table: Description...
2 In all states, removing the Enable signal returns the FCM-802/804 to the module controller off state. 3 If the FCM-802/804 enters a fault condition the fault is latched. The Enable line must be cycled to clear it. 4 For start and stop criteria see section 13 Control parameters and standard factory setting.
Operation of FCM-802/804 Overview FCM 802/804 The FCM-802/804 provides regulated DC at nominal 24V or 48V output to a battery bus. The DC bus will be held at nominal voltage by a battery or external supply to act as a hybrid system. In the hybrid system, the battery is used to provide power whilst the fuel cell starts.
10.1 Mechanical mounting points The FCM-802/804 must be installed as a standard 19" rack unit. This should then be mounted on a flat surface with four retaining points, these must be tightened to a torque not exceeding 25Nm. When installing the FCM, inspect it and do not install if there is visible damage to the unit.
10.5 Vibration and shock loads The mounting of the FCM-802/804 must ensure that it is not exposed to shock or vibration loads. Ensure that the FCM-802/804 is stationary while it is operating. Note: If the FCM has been stressed due to vibration or shock, return to Intelligent Energy for investigation.

The FCM-802/804 will consume less than 70g/kWh at rated power. This is equivalent to 34sl/min (FCM-802) and 56sl/min (FCM-804) at rated power. It must be noted that the flow will spike high during hydrogen purges, which, if poorly regulated, can lead to a low pressure fault of the FCM.
